1 Katie is raising money to buy
a dog. She starts a
neighborhood babysitting service.
She paid $40 for a CPR class and
charges $5 per kid. Write an
equation she could use to calculate
her profit, p, if she has k kids.
O p = 5k - 40
P = 5k + 40
O p = 40k + 5
k = 40p - 5

p = 5k - 40
Step-by-step explanation:
Since we're finding the profit (p), it's not the last answer choice because it's finding kids (k).
Because we have to take out from her profit whatever Katie spent, we would have -40.
Because she'd charging $5 per kid, or $5 per k, we would have 5k.
So now we know the profit is whatever she makes, then minus whatever she spent. So:
p = 5k (what she makes) - 40 (what she spent)
p = 5k - 40
